7545 Mount Vernon St, Riverside, CA 92504 is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,138 sqft single-family home in Ramona, built in 1946. It last sold for $560,000 on Dec 1, 2025. More recently, it was listed as a rental in April 2026 with an asking price of $2,800 per month. That rental listing was removed on May 5, 2026.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$561,400, with a rent estimate of $2,890/month.
